7 Maleo (Macrocephalon maleo) nesting site©© Published January 5, 2011 at 800 × 600 in Macrocephalon Maleo – The Mute Missionary… ← Previous Next → Share this: Click to email a link to a friend (Opens in new window) Email More Click to share on Pinterest (Opens in new window) Pinterest Like Loading...